Twitter is one of the leading social media platforms available on the internet today. It was created by Jack Dorsey, Biz Stone, Noah Glass, and Evan Williams in March 2006. The platform allows users to connect with each other and share their thoughts via text, photos, videos, and GIFs. How many Twitter users are there globally?
Despite all the changes implemented on the platform since Elon Musk acquired it, Twitter still remains among the top 15 most popular social media platforms today.

In the first quarter of 2023, the platform had 259.4 million active users daily with 396.5 million users globally. The number may seem small compared to the number of users on Facebook and Instagram, but it's still quite huge, and Twitter has held a secure place in the social media market since it went public in 2013.
Important Twitter Usage Statistics
Below are some other interesting Twitter usage statistics you should know about:
- As of October 2021, there were 19.05 million Twitter accounts registered in the UK. And more than half of the accounts are owned by males.
- Over 500 million tweets are sent on the platform daily.
- Adults in the U.S. spend an average of 6 minutes daily on the platform.
- In 2020, 52% of all tweets sent on the platform were from Gen-Z users (those born around 1997 – 2012).
- Adults in the UK spend an average of 4 minutes on the platform daily.
- In the U.S., 52% of users reported that they check Twitter daily, 84% say they use the platform weekly, and 96% say they only use the platform monthly.
- The most popular age group on Twitter are 25-34-year-olds.
- The U.S. has the most number of Twitter users, while Japan is the second.
